Opportunities and Domestic Barriers to Clean Energy Investment in Chile
This report analyzes the clean energy market for electricity generation in Chile, examining the current state of the electricity grid, investment trends, and the regulatory framework. It identifies significant potential for non-conventional renewable energy (NCRE) but highlights substantial economic, regulatory, and financial barriers that hinder large-scale adoption.

Energy Service Companies (ESCOs) in Developing Countries
This report examines the potential, status, and barriers facing Energy Service Companies (ESCOs) in developing countries. It analyzes how ESCOs use energy performance contracting (EPC) to reduce greenhouse gas emissions and energy consumption, highlighting China as a major success story while identifying systemic financing, administrative, and policy hurdles in other regions.

Powering Healthcare – Nigeria Market Assessment and Roadmap
This document is a technical deep-dive report titled 'Stakeholder Mapping & Key Policies,' which serves as the first of five supplements to the 'Powering Healthcare Market Assessment and Roadmap for Nigeria.' Developed by Sustainable Energy for All (SEforALL) under the Power Africa-funded Powering Healthcare Africa Project, the report analyzes the intersection of energy access and healthcare delivery in Nigeria. It maps the regulatory landscape for renewable energy and health, identifies key institutional stakeholders across federal, state, and local government levels, and catalogs past, ongoing, and planned electrification interventions for health facilities.

Taking the Pulse Madagascar Case Study
This case study analyzes the energy access landscape in Madagascar, focusing on the financing and infrastructure requirements to achieve universal electricity and clean cooking access by 2030. It contrasts a 'business as usual' (BAU) scenario, where grid access declines due to population growth, with a forecast scenario requiring significant investment in stand-alone solar, mini-grids, and improved cookstoves (ICS). The report highlights profound affordability challenges for rural households and the need for quality standards and regulatory consistency to attract private investment.
